Yes, there's an idle adjustment under the small hatch under the seat.  Phillips head screwdriver will do it.  Idle is 1400rpm plus or minus 500rpm with engine WELL warmed up.  I'd guess bad gas so you might need to re-adjust after getting some good gas going through it.   Run some Sea Foam or StarTron in it.  It might clear up in a couple of tankfuls.

Only a few hundred miles or not - it's a 5 year old scooter.  There are seals and fluids that need to be changed regardless of use, gasoline sitting for years turns into varnish with residue.  Some of that residue may have been loosened up by the additives in your premium fuel and is now causing your carb problems.  Running a few tanks of seafoam may get it to run through or it may clog the carb - requiring a carb overhaul.  Nothing to lose by doing it - as a carb rebuild would actually be my first choice.

I'd also replace front and rear brake fluid, coolant, engine oil and transmission oil, fuel filter, and check the air filter.
